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Question:
The property at the listed address has a seepage pit that seems to be overflowing. It drains across a public road, onto my property, down my driveway and stands on Topanga Canyon Blvd. This situation has existed for a long time. As I read the codes, that situation makes the house uninhabitable. Can Building and Safety terminate this nuisance?

Answer:
Please contact the County of Los Angeles Department of Environmental Health Services at (626) 430 5380 to report your concerns regarding the private sewage disposal system. A link to the Report-a-Problem page is provided for your convenience.
